Understanding Caffeine and Decaffeination
Caffeine is a naturally occurring stimulant found in the leaves, seeds, and fruits of over 60 plant species worldwide. In coffee, caffeine serves as a natural pesticide, helping to protect the plant from insects and other predators. The amount of caffeine in coffee beans varies depending on factors like the coffee species, growing conditions, and processing methods. Arabica beans, for instance, generally contain less caffeine than Robusta beans.

Methods of Decaffeination
The most common methods of decaffeination include the Swiss Water method, the direct solvent method, and the carbon dioxide method. The Swiss Water method is considered one of the most chemical-free and environmentally friendly processes. It involves soaking the beans in water, allowing the caffeine to dissolve out, and then using an activated carbon filter to remove the caffeine from the water. The beans are then dried to their original moisture level.
Evaluating the Claim of Completely Caffeine-Free Coffee
While decaffeination methods can significantly reduce the caffeine content in coffee, the question remains as to whether it’s possible to achieve a completely caffeine-free coffee. The US FDA requires that decaffeinated coffee contain no more than 0.1% caffeine by weight on a dry basis in the green coffee beans. The European Union sets a slightly stricter standard, with decaffeinated coffee not exceeding 0.3% caffeine.

Challenges in Achieving Zero Caffeine
The main challenge in achieving completely caffeine-free coffee lies in the fact that caffeine is an integral part of the coffee bean’s composition. Even the most stringent decaffeination processes cannot guarantee the removal of 100% of the caffeine. Additionally, there might be trace amounts of caffeine that are not detectable by current testing methods. Thus, while decaffeinated coffee can be a viable option for those looking to minimize their caffeine intake, claiming that it is completely caffeine-free might not be entirely accurate.
Alternatives to Traditional Decaffeination
For those who are adamant about avoiding caffeine altogether, there are alternatives to traditional coffee that are naturally caffeine-free. These include herbal coffees made from roots, grains, and other plant materials that mimic the flavor and experience of coffee without the caffeine. Roasted chicory root, for example, is a popular alternative that provides a rich, earthy flavor similar to coffee.

Is it possible to find completely caffeine-free coffee, or are there always trace amounts of caffeine present?
While it is possible to find coffee that is labeled as “caffeine-free” or “decaf,” it is unlikely that any coffee is completely caffeine-free. The decaffeination process is not 100% effective, and small amounts of caffeine may still be present in the coffee. Additionally, some coffee manufacturers may use lower-quality beans or less effective decaffeination methods, which can result in higher levels of residual caffeine. However, for most people, the small amounts of caffeine present in decaf coffee are not significant enough to cause any noticeable effects.
The FDA allows coffee to be labeled as “decaf” if it contains less than 0.1% caffeine by weight. This means that a 12-ounce cup of decaf coffee could still contain up to 12 milligrams of caffeine. While this amount is generally considered safe for most adults, it may still be a concern for people who are highly sensitive to caffeine or who need to avoid it for medical reasons. If you are looking for completely caffeine-free coffee, you may want to consider alternatives such as herbal tea or roasted grain beverages, which are naturally caffeine-free.
How is the caffeine removed from coffee, and are there different methods used?
There are several methods used to remove caffeine from coffee, including the direct solvent method, indirect solvent method, and Swiss Water method. The direct solvent method involves soaking the green coffee beans in a solvent, such as methylene chloride or ethyl acetate, to extract the caffeine. The indirect solvent method involves soaking the beans in water, then using a solvent to remove the caffeine from the water. The Swiss Water method uses a water-based process to remove the caffeine, which is considered to be a more natural and chemical-free method.
The choice of decaffeination method can affect the flavor and quality of the decaf coffee. Some methods, such as the direct solvent method, can result in a loss of flavor and aroma compounds, while others, such as the Swiss Water method, can help preserve the natural flavor and aroma of the coffee. Additionally, some coffee manufacturers may use a combination of methods or proprietary techniques to remove caffeine from their coffee.
